Keno is a game of luck with a rich and acclaimed history. The game that we are familiar with has experienced remarkable alterations since its earliest appearance. Gaming historians have traced its background as far back as 200 B.C. to a Chinese type of amusement called ‘The Game of the White Dove.’ It is a accurately-documented fact that a type of keno was played in a bingo-like arrangement on the eastern seaboard just around the time of the huge Chinese arrival at the time of the gold rush.
In its current style, keno is something like bingo in that the pair of games are based upon numbers. An individual keno card comes with eighty numbers and the player is able to select as many as s/he would like. This is completed by marking the numbers using a pencil. After the bettor has selected the numbers, s/he must bring the card back to the person at the keno stand. The cashier will then issue a ticket after recording the gambler’s numbers. It is the responsibility of the player to trade in any winning card before the upcoming round begins, so stragglers must stay alert.
